A vibrant 100x150cm abstract painting of a spring garden capturing the buzzing energy of spring as subtle bees dart between honey drips and sunlit daisies. Hexagonal patterns echo the order of the hive, while thick textures & flowing paint mirror the movement of nature’s endless cycle, growth, pollination, and renewal. With hues of blue, yellow, black, and fiery orange, this piece celebrates the harmony of bees, blossoms, and the eco-rhythm of life in springtime.

Eternal Spring represents the close of the Bee Series.

Original Art & Fine Art Prints Handmade in Oxfordshire

I use a variety of materials in my process. From brushes and pallet knives to cardboard scraps and sticks. My work is largely acrylic paint, whichever brand I can get on offer, and my preffered mediums are either Windsor and Newton or Liquitex.

Once signed and varnished, I photograph my paintings in natural light and crop to standard print sizes, adjusting levels to ensure as accurate a match to the original as possible. Once exported I print on my inkjet Epson P-900 SureColour. Tis a sexy beast.

I print onto a variety of papers, including high gloss and watercolour. My larger prints use satin 260gsm and my extra large prints (A1 & A0) are handled by a top notch local third party printing service I've been working with for years.
